Madzore
bail application postponed again
Zimbabwe Lawyers for Human Rights (ZLHR)
November 22, 2011
High Court Judge,
Justice Maria Zimba Dube on Tuesday 22 November 2011 postponed the
bail hearing of Movement for Democratic Change (MDC) Youth Assembly
chairperson, Solomon Madzore, who is accused
of murdering a police officer, Inspector Petros Mutedza to Wednesday
23 November 2011.
The postponement
was the fourth one inside one week after several deferments last
week by Justice Hlekani Mwayera.
Justice Dube
on Tuesday 22 November 2011 postponed the hearing after requesting
for time to peruse the State's response to the fresh bail
application for Madzore which was filed by his lawyer Gift Mtisi
of Musendekwa and Mtisi Legal Practitioners.
In his fresh
bail application, which is being opposed by the State Madzore's
lawyer argues that his client now deserves to be granted bail because
of changed circumstances and that enough time has elapsed to allow
the police to complete investigations as per their indications.
Mtisi has also
filed an affidavit deposed to by a medical doctor confirming that
Madzore was nowhere near the incident as he had accompanied his
wife to the doctor's chambers.
Madzore was
arrested early last month and charged with murdering Inspector Mutedza.
Justice Mwayera
dismissed his first bail application last month after ruling that
he was a flight risk.
